Cypress wood is considered to be moderately hard, ranking around 350 on the Janka hardness scale. While it is not as hard as some hardwoods like oak or maple, it is still durable and resistant to decay, making it suitable for outdoor applications. Its natural oils also contribute to its resistance to moisture and insects. Overall, cypress wood strikes a good balance between workability and durability.

Why do deciduous trees have hard wood?

Not all do. Some deciduous trees such as the larch and cypress are classified as "Softwood". Some hardwood trees like Balsa have wood that is much softer than most softwoods. You can look at Hard and Soft to be the distinction between flowering trees and gymnosperms. It really has little to do with the hardness of the wood.

Can you burn Cypress wood?

Yes, you can burn Cypress wood, but it may not be the best choice for firewood. Cypress has a high oil content, which can make it burn hotter and produce more smoke than other types of wood. Additionally, it can create creosote buildup in chimneys, so it's important to use it in well-ventilated areas or with proper chimney maintenance. Overall, while it is burnable, care should be taken when using Cypress for fires.
